    • @perrythebarber
      @perrythebarber  Před rokem +2

      6500 will be quieter And not wair out the parts As fast And those are beasts they cut fast I'm knocking them out 20 minutes each I'm glad my friend asked me to fix them So I fixed him two pair for free. I actually swapped out my 272 hundreds for 265 hundreds That's the way to go So so quiet bands are necessary To make the lid fit in the groove tight And a new yoke, spring, gasket, It's in the video..
